While some decry the spread of social media, the fact is it can make our lives much easier when we use it the right way.

It’s no different in the world of recruiting: If you can build and leverage relationships with candidates on social media, it will be much easier to find and recruit top talent.

However, few people know how to properly recruit via social media. Many assume they can simply blast out friend requests, but that just isn’t the way to build a quality talent pool.

On this episode of The Recruiting Reel, we talked with Ted Rubin, cofounder of Prevailing Path and acting chief marketing officer at Brand Innovators. With an extensive background in marketing, Rubin brings an interesting perspective to the issue of effective recruiting on social media.
